Output 1651aca7f3b1ea7b49f264004524fa7d86eb396d5d76c2a78b7126c1b666d558:1

value
2716000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ddae53c550384a6bdcc27a7bee7a949fdf2935e9 OP_EQUAL
address
3MuA6QXpLD7jX4DDCBFWEaSpYtddxc32ci
transaction
1651aca7f3b1ea7b49f264004524fa7d86eb396d5d76c2a78b7126c1b666d558
spent
true